Output 0aaf8c830ba66615dc85ab14c3a0d930dcd55549da04e1aadfd2cc1be96f83ac:631

value
590781
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e6e7818d5b3f8345f918466fae1fc8495219fffedd512729eae4ae4f985d8450
address
tb1pumncrr2m87p5t7gcgeh6u87gf9fpnll7m4gjw202ujhylxzas3gq30y63x
transaction
0aaf8c830ba66615dc85ab14c3a0d930dcd55549da04e1aadfd2cc1be96f83ac
confirmations
18172
spent
false

1 Sat Range